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5229756129 55424747100 3712
4160 10
4160 10
5576618 733 4423 188 74
All about undefined
Interested in learning more?
4160 10
5576618 733 4423 188 74
See more
852 32524 443137460
092 54736 37009557491
See more
62700 7963 178385214
042654 647 43848561688 95
See more